[GTALUG-Announce] Special Event: Seatbelts and Airbags for Bash w/ Michael Potter

hi at gtalug.org hi at gtalug.org
Tue Oct 16 10:23:53 EDT 2018


# Special Event: Seatbelts and Airbags for Bash w/ Michael Potter

https://www.eventbrite.ca/e/seatbelts-and-airbags-for-bash-tickets-51177497272

## Date and Time

Wed, 17 October 2018
6:45 PM – 9:00 PM EDT


# Location

Hacklab.TO
1266 Queen Street West
Suite #6
Toronto, Ontario M6K 1L3


# Abstract:
This presentation will focus on the underutilized features of bash that are
critical to building production quality scripts. Demos will show you how to
turn on options and error trapping that expose the hidden time bombs in the
code.


Turning these features on should be considered a requirement, much like turning
on “strict” and “warnings” is considered a requirement for Perl programs.

Also, as much of the bash syntax has become outdated, the presentation will
explain which syntax is best to use and which syntax to avoid.

Knowledge of any of the common UNIX scripting languages will be sufficient to
understand the presentation and script authors at all proficiency levels should
find value in attending. Although the presentation does not address differences
between Korn shell and bash, much of what will be discussed also applies to
Korn shell.

# Bio:
Michael Potter is a long time UNIX user and C developer and more recently a
consultant to insurance companies. He is a proponent of strongly typed
languages which inspired him to try to "fix" bash by using its underutilized
features to make it more reliable.

Please arrive early to be seated, presentation will start at 7pm sharp.



More information about the announce mailing list